Craftsmanship Rules for Judging

  1. All participants must have reference pictures of their costume character; without proper reference material, the judges cannot assess the accuracy of a costume. Please bring printouts, manga, art books, or any other form of reference material for the Judges to use to aid them in their task.


  2. Craftsmanship is the assessment of the costumer's skill at making a costume.


  3. Any costume that consists mostly of bought items will not be considered for craftsmanship judging (ie. buying regular street clothes that require no alterations). Only 10% of your costume may consist of bought items. 90% must be created by you.

    If you commissioned your costume, it will not be considered for craftsmanship judging. You cannot receive credit for another person's work.

    Questions about this should be addressed to Cosplay@nekocon.com.

  4. Craftsmanship registration forms will be available at the Cosplay Rehearsal. Please see the Craftsmanship Head judge for your forms to be filled out and brought with you at the time you will be judged.

    Please fill out the registration form completely and bring all reference material for your character(s) to the Craftsmanship Judging.

  5. Craftsmanship judging will take place before the Cosplay Masquerade and is dealt with on a first come first served basis.

    Once your forms are filled out you are free to show up to be judged.

    The location of the Judging will be announced at the Cosplay Rehearsal.

  6. Doors will close 15 minutes before the end of judging to make sure all entrants have been dealt with. No exceptions. If you miss this time you forfeit your Craftsmanship entry.
